Can videos in spanish bridge the cancer care gap?

NCT ID NCT05351424

Summary

This study is testing whether Spanish-language educational videos can help Latinx patients better understand their radiation therapy for breast or prostate cancer. Researchers want to see if these videos improve treatment adherence and make patients more open to joining future cancer clinical trials. The study compares the video approach to traditional written brochures.
